Lawyer 2 Lawyer - Inside Trump’s Criminal Cases

Inside Trump’s Criminal Cases

02/16/24 • 40 min

Lawyer 2 Lawyer

For the past two episodes of Lawyer2Lawyer, we have covered SCOTUS cases that have included ballot access and immunity with former President Trump at the forefront of these cases. Trump has also been charged in four criminal cases.

In this episode, Craig is joined by professor Tamara R. Lave, from the University of Miami, as they spotlight these upcoming criminal cases of Trump, whether these cases will go to trial before the presidential election, and possible punishment.
